Mastering Health Information Systems and Informatics
Informatics has evolved into the central nervous system of patient safety and organizational efficiency. As nursing curricula increasingly focus on how digital tools mitigate human error, students are tasked with evaluating the efficacy of health information technology. When you are faced with a complex task such as nurs fpx 4015 assessment 5 you are being asked to demonstrate how data flows influence clinical outcomes. To excel here, you must look beyond the user interface and understand the ethical and logistical implications of integrated health systems.
A practical hack for informatics-based assignments is to use a "Current-State vs. Future-State" analysis based on your actual clinical unit. Identify a technological bottleneck—perhaps a redundant documentation step or an ineffective alert system—and research how specific informatics interventions could resolve it. By grounding your academic research in the realities of your daily shift, you create a more compelling, authentic narrative. Instructors value students who can bridge the gap between the IT department and the front-line nursing staff, ensuring that technology serves the caregiver rather than creating additional hurdles.
Furthermore, always stay updated on the ethical stewardship of patient data. As healthcare moves toward increasingly integrated cloud-based systems, the nurse’s role as a protector of patient privacy has expanded into the cyber realm. In your writing, discuss the balance between seamless data access for providers and the robust protection of sensitive information. This level of comprehensive thinking—combining technical knowledge with ethical oversight—is exactly what prepares you for executive-level decision-making in the future.
Strategic Advocacy and Healthcare Policy Analysis
As you move into the leadership-focused portions of your degree, the focus shifts from individual bedside care to the broader healthcare system. This requires a "macro" perspective, where you analyze how legislative changes, insurance mandates, and organizational policies dictate the quality of care. When you encounter a challenge like nurs fpx 4065 assessment 4 you are being asked to step into the role of a policy advocate. You must identify a gap in care, such as health disparities in a specific community, and propose a sustainable, evidence-based change that considers fiscal constraints and stakeholder buy-in.
To produce a professional-grade policy analysis, you should utilize the "Stakeholder Mapping" technique. Before you begin writing, list every group affected by a policy change—from the hospital CFO and the nursing staff to the patients and their local representatives. Address the potential resistance each group might have and offer evidence-based strategies to overcome these hurdles. This shows a level of maturity and strategic thinking that is highly valued in nursing management. It proves that you understand that healthcare change is a social and political process as much as a clinical one.
Additionally, pay close attention to the Social Determinants of Health (SDOH) in your advocacy work. In 2026, healthcare excellence is defined by how well we address root causes such as housing instability or food insecurity. By integrating these factors into your policy proposals, you demonstrate that you are a forward-thinking leader who understands the holistic nature of modern medicine. This perspective not only earns higher marks but also prepares you for the realities of public health leadership, where you will be expected to solve complex, multi-layered problems that extend far beyond the hospital walls.
The Capstone Milestone: Synthesis and Professional Impact
The culmination of an advanced nursing program is the capstone project—a comprehensive synthesis of your entire educational journey. This is your opportunity to lead a quality improvement initiative and demonstrate your readiness for advanced practice or doctoral-level leadership. A significant portion of this involves the nurs fpx 4905 assessment 5 which typically focuses on the final reporting and dissemination of your project’s findings. The capstone is your "professional calling card," and it should be treated with the highest level of care, reflecting your ability to influence the healthcare landscape positively and sustainably.
To manage the immense scale of a capstone project, you must adopt a project management mindset. Break the project down into manageable phases: problem identification, literature review, intervention design, data collection, and final evaluation. Set hard deadlines for yourself for each phase to avoid a last-minute scramble. Use a "Project Journal" to keep track of your thoughts and the barriers you encounter during the process. These reflections often make for the most compelling sections of your final report, as they show your ability to pivot and problem-solve in real-time.
Finally, consider the long-term sustainability of your work. A distinguished project doesn't just end when the grade is posted; it offers a solution that could potentially be adopted by your clinical facility or scaled to other units. When writing your final report, include a section on "Sustainability and Scalability." Discuss how your intervention can be maintained after the project ends and how it could be adapted for different departments. This forward-thinking perspective is what separates a student project from a professional-grade quality improvement initiative, marking your final transition from a learner to a leader who is ready to shape the future of the profession.
